Boxers USA John Ruiz [41-6-1, 28]
USA James Toney [68-4-2, 43]
Referee cards 111-116; 111-116; 112-115
Comment This fight was originally a unanimous decision (116-111; 116-111; 115-112) win for James Toney. Following this bout James Toney tested positive for a banned substance and the decision was changed to a "No Contest" by the New York State Athletic Commission on Wednesday May 11th
Weight division Heavyweight (unlimited)
Title WBA Title,
Date 30 April 2005, Sat
Location USA USA, New York, Madison Square Garden

WBA reinstates John Ruiz! 18 May 2005 13:22

WBA reinstates John Ruiz!

"To all of the ***holes who want me out of the game...I'm back!" That's what heavyweight John Ruiz said after Team Ruiz was notified yesterday by the WBA that it has reinstated John "The Quietman" Ruiz as WBA heavyweight champion, effectively immediately. A WBA letter adressed to James Toney read: "Based on the actions of the New York State Athletic Commission and the test results on which the Commission relied, the WBA must vacate your championship ranking and reinstate John Ruiz as the champion..." read more ...
TONEY SUSPENDED; FINED! 12 May 2005 12:28

TONEY SUSPENDED; FINED!

According to the Fight Fax web site’s suspension list, James “Lights Out” Toney has been suspended for 90 days and fined $10,000 for testing positive for a banned substance. In addition, and perhaps more importantly, his April 30 WBA title-winning victory over John Ruiz has been changed to a No Decision. While the implications of this decision are not known, the most likely scenario will see the title returned to Ruiz outright. Toney will apparently be re-tested after his 90-day suspension is served. read more ...
Toney tested positive! 11 May 2005 13:24

Toney tested positive!

Newly crowned WBA heavyweight champion James Toney has reportedly tested positive for an anabolic steroid in a post-fight drug test. According to longtime boxing writer Wallace Matthews of Newsday, Toney's promoter Dan Goossen was informed Monday night by the New York State Athletic Commission that Toney had "tested positive for a banned substance that is not a narcotic." read more ...
